Over the weekend, Space 15 Twenty debuted a film project sure to be close to music lovers' hearts. “Main Street,” described as “an exhibition of new video art and animation,” runs through December 6 and features brief displays of visual greatness by auteurs from L.A. and beyond. Among those who've contributed are a few well known for either making music, or making images to accompany it. West Coast Sound favorites and multimedia masters Lucky Dragons are featured, as are all-around performance artist Miranda July (who's got two records in the Kill Rock Stars catalog) and Paper Rad, the freaky East Coast pixelcore collective. Space 15 Twenty is located at 1520 North Cahuenga Boulevard, 90028. Other artists featured include Andrew Jeffrey Wright, Jacob Ciocci, Kris Moyes, Peter Sutherland, Andrew Sutherland, Lori D., and Melanie Bonajo. Entry/viewing is free.
